How SearScore Works

Every restaurant in Austin gets a single composite score from 0 to 100. That number comes from four independent signal pillars, each measuring something different about why a place matters.

The Four Pillars

Review Intelligence (35%)

Aggregated ratings and sentiment across Google, Yelp, and niche platforms. We weight recent reviews more heavily and factor in volume, consistency, and specificity. A place with 200 genuine 4.5-star reviews outscores a place with 50 perfect 5-stars and obvious fake reviews.

Editorial Pedigree (30%)

Coverage from food critics, magazines, and trusted publications. Being named to the Eater 38 or a Texas Monthly Top 50 list carries weight. We track recency, frequency, and the authority of the source. One mention in a major outlet is good. Sustained coverage over years is better.

Local Canon Momentum (20%)

Is this place woven into Austin's food identity? Locals-only favorites, neighborhood institutions, and the spots that define a district all score here. We measure cultural staying power and community attachment. Some places are new but already feel essential. Others have been here for decades and still pack the house.

Platform Engagement (15%)

How Sear's own users interact with a place: saves, shares, plan additions, and profile visits. This pillar is intentionally weighted lowest to prevent gaming, but it captures real-time demand signals that the other pillars miss. When something's trending on Sear, you'll see it here first.

What SearScore is not

  • Not pay-to-play. No restaurant can buy a higher score. No ads in the rankings.
  • Not static. Scores recalculate daily. A place that slips gets reflected immediately.
  • Not one-dimensional. Yelp measures reviews. Eater measures editorial opinion. Sear measures everything together.
  • Not perfect. The system improves continuously. Some places have incomplete data. Signal count and confidence bars show you how much data backs each score.

Heat Badges

Every place gets a heat badge based on its current SearScore range and trajectory:

🔥 On Fire85+Elite tier. Dominant across all pillars.
♨️ Still Hot75-84Strong and steady. Consistently excellent.
🌟 New Heat65-74Rising fast. Worth watching closely.
❄️ Cooling Off50-64Dipping. Still in the conversation.
🧊 Gone ColdBelow 50Fallen off. The data shows it.
